When the news of Malcolm-Jamal Warner’s death broke, it was already devastating. The beloved actor, best known for playing Theo Huxtable on The Cosby Show, had drowned in Costa Rica at age 54. Early reports suggested he had been swimming with his 8-year-old daughter, who was miraculously rescued from the current.

But that version of events, it turns out, wasn’t true.

What Actually Happened to Malcolm-Jamal Warner

On Friday, Costa Rica’s Judicial Investigation Agency (OIJ) clarified the timeline of Warner’s final moments. Contrary to earlier reports, his daughter was not in the water with him. In a translated statement to People, officials explained that Warner had been playing with his daughter on the shoreline but left her on the sand before entering the ocean with a friend.

“It was at that moment that they were swept away by the current,” the OIJ said. “The friend managed to get out. However, Mr. Warner was unable to get out and was pulled out by several people on the beach. He received care from Red Cross officials, but was pronounced dead at the scene.”

The cause of death was confirmed as asphyxiation by submersion.

The Doctor Who Tried to Save Him

One of the people who helped recover Warner’s body—a vacationing doctor—spoke anonymously to Us Weekly, offering a harrowing eyewitness account. The physician recalled hearing screams while relaxing on Playa Grande, a notoriously rough beach without active lifeguards.

“There were very few people on the beach, and the sea was rough,” he said. Grabbing his surfboard, he sprinted toward the crowd and paddled into the rip current. “After a few minutes, I saw a shadow, dove down, and pulled the person out.”

That person was Warner.

Back on the shore, another bystander who had also entered the water was collapsed in the sand, struggling to breathe. According to the doctor, both of them had acted on instinct—no training, no equipment, just adrenaline.

Emergency responders arrived within minutes. CPR was performed. A defibrillator was used. Two tourists who identified themselves as medical professionals joined the effort. But nothing worked. Warner had no vital signs.

A Beach Known for Its Danger

Playa Grande is infamous among local surfers for its strong currents—and its lack of resources. On the day Warner drowned, no lifeguards were on duty.

“We deeply regret the passing of Malcolm-Jamal Warner at Playa Grande,” Costa Rica’s volunteer lifeguard association posted on Facebook. “He was swept away by a strong rip current and died by drowning. It all happened very quickly… Despite CPR maneuvers being performed on the beach, resuscitation was unsuccessful.”

The beach is lined with bilingual warning signs alerting tourists to the deadly conditions. Still, tragedies like this continue to happen—fast, quiet, and irreversible.

A Legacy Complicated and Undeniable

Warner’s body has since been released to his family and was expected to be flown back to Los Angeles. He had reportedly traveled to Costa Rica as part of a homeschooling program with his daughter. His wife, who was not in the country at the time, received the news over the phone.

Best known for his work on The Cosby Show, Warner was once one of the most recognizable young faces on television. He earned an Emmy nomination at just 16. In recent years, he remained active onscreen and vocal about the complicated legacy of the show that made him famous, particularly in light of Bill Cosby’s overturned conviction.

“You can’t discount its impact on television culture and American culture,” he told The Post in 2021.

Now, that legacy carries a new layer of sorrow—and a haunting reminder of how quickly life can be swept away.
